The primary immune response involves
arsen [322]

Answer:

The correct answer is- a slow rise in the concentration of antibodies, followed by a rapid decline.

Explanation:

The first exposure of antibody in an organism generates the primary response. Initially, for some days after the exposure of antigen, there is no antibody detection in the blood and it is called the latent phase.  

After the latent or lag phase, the antibodies start accumulating and reach to the peak between 7-10 days after exposure. So it takes a longer time to establish immunity in primary response.

After the immunity reaches the peak it declines rapidly that means higher immunity does not stay for a longer time. This phase is called the declining phase. Therefore, the correct answer is- a slow rise in the concentration of antibodies, followed by a rapid decline.
